  0 Thread: Finish for Cedar?
Post: RE: Finish for Cedar?

This cedar planter, is finished with Minwax Tung and teak oil. Surface prep, was just off the thickness planer. The oil needs to be reapplied every year to keep it looking fresh, and cedar like.
